How they compare

Turks and Caicos Islands currently reports 0.8232 current LCU per US$ of GDP against 0.8131 current LCU per US$ of GDP in Malta, a difference of 0.0101 current LCU per US$ of GDP.

The two have swapped places 2 times across 24 shared years of data; in 2001 it was Malta ahead.

Malta ranks 174th and Turks and Caicos Islands ranks 172nd of 205 countries.

Turks and Caicos Islands has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.
